(See accompanying +// file LICENSE_1_0.txt or copy at http://www.boost.org/LICENSE_1_0.txt) +// + +#include <iostream> +#include <string> +#include "asio.hpp" +#include "boost/bind.hpp" + +const short multicast_port = 30001; + +class receiver +{ +public: + receiver(asio::io_context& io_context, + const asio::ip::address& listen_address, + const asio::ip::address& multicast_address) + : socket_(io_context) + { + // Create the socket so that multiple may be bound to the same address. + asio::ip::udp::endpoint listen_endpoint( + listen_address, multicast_port); + socket_.open(listen_endpoint.protocol()); + socket_.set_option(asio::ip::udp::socket::reuse_address(true)); + socket_.bind(listen_endpoint); + + // Join the multicast group. + socket_.set_option( + asio::ip::multicast::join_group(multicast_address)); + + socket_.async_receive_from( + asio::buffer(data_, max_length), sender_endpoint_, + boost::bind(&receiver::handle_receive_from, this, + asio::placeholders::error, + asio::placeholders::bytes_transferred)); + } + + void handle_receive_from(const asio::error_code& error, + size_t bytes_recvd) + { + if (!error) + { + std::cout.write(data_, bytes_recvd); + std::cout << std::endl; + + socket_.async_receive_from( + asio::buffer(data_, max_length), sender_endpoint_, + boost::bind(&receiver::handle_receive_from, this, + asio::placeholders::error, + asio::placeholders::bytes_transferred)); + } + } + +private: + asio::ip::udp::socket socket_; + asio::ip::udp::endpoint sender_endpoint_; + enum { max_length = 1024 }; + char data_[max_length]; +}; + +int main(int argc, char* argv[]) +{ + try + { + if (argc != 3) + { + std::cerr << "Usage: receiver <listen_address> <multicast_address>\n"; + std::cerr << " For IPv4, try:\n"; + std::cerr << " receiver 0.0.0.0 239.255.0.1\n"; + std::cerr << " For IPv6, try:\n"; + std::cerr << " receiver 0::0 ff31::8000:1234\n"; + return 1; + } + + asio::io_context io_context; + receiver r(io_context, + asio::ip::make_address(argv[1]), + asio::ip::make_address(argv[2])); + io_context.run(); + } + catch (std::exception& e) + { + std::cerr << "Exception: " << e.what() << "\n"; + } + + return 0; +} |
